About the Department:

The Office of Strategic Initiatives, Innovation, and College Affairs within the College of Science will advance the college’s mission through visionary leadership, strategic planning, and cross-functional collaboration. The unit is responsible for identifying and implementing transformative initiatives that enhance academic excellence, student and faculty success, and community engagement. It serves as a catalyst for interdisciplinary collaboration, institutional alignment, and continuous improvement, ensuring the college remains responsive to emerging trends in science education.

About the Position:

The Senior Associate Dean for Strategic Initiatives, Innovation, and College Affairs will be a vital member of the Mason Science executive leadership team. This position is charged with the planning, execution, and continuation of strategies for innovation and excellence in the areas of academic, student, and faculty affairs, strategic enrollment management, and community engagement. This position additionally serves as the college’s deputy, acting for the Dean when the Dean is unavailable.

Responsibilities:

College Affairs Leadership and Operations

  • Oversees the college affairs functions and offices in the position portfolio;
  • Ensures continuous alignment with the college’s mission and strategic plan, monitoring progress and evaluating performance;
  • Oversees the college’s strategy for development, implementation, and evaluation of academic programs and student support;
  • Oversees the college's enrollment management strategy, including setting both new and continuing student targets, recruitment, marketing, admissions, and student support and retention;
  • Oversees the college’s strategy and processes for faculty recruitment, hiring, development, and performance evaluation; 
  • Manages direct reports to ensure collaboration and continuity among them and their associated teams;
  • Serves as a liaison between the Dean’s Office and academic departments to ensure alignment and effective implementation of initiatives; and
  • By request, attends meetings and directs the college on the Dean’s behalf.

Strategic Initiatives and Innovation

  • Leads the implementation and assesses progress of strategic initiatives as identified in the college’s strategic plan, as well as related initiatives as directed by the Dean;
  • Promotes a culture of innovation and collaborates with stakeholders to identify and assess emerging strategic opportunities for the college;
  • Monitors progression toward goals, including data analysis and tracking of key performance indicators; and
  • Supports the development of interdisciplinary programs, new academic offerings, and cross-unit collaborations.

Internal and External Relations

  • Collaborates with the college’s research, business operations, advancement and communications teams to support and promote the college’s initiatives and achievements;
  • Represents the college in university-wide committees and task forces;
  • Fosters collaborative and transparent communication, both internal and external to the college; and
  • Oversees special projects and performs other related duties as assigned by the Dean.
